Nabekura Station (鍋倉駅, Nabekura-eki) is a passenger railway station located in the city of Yamaguchi, Yamaguchi Prefecture, Japan. It is operated by the West Japan Railway Company (JR West).[1]
Nabekura Station is served by the JR West Yamaguchi Line, and is located 46.4 kilometers from the terminus of the line at Shin-Yamaguchi.
The station consists of one ground-level side platform serving a single bi-directional line. There is no station building, but only a small shelter on the platform. The station is unattended.
Nabekura Station was opened on 17 July 1962 as a temporary stop and elevated to the status of a full passenger station on 1 October 1963. With the privatization of the Japan National Railway (JNR) on 1 April 1987, the station came under the aegis of the West Japan railway Company (JR West).
In fiscal 2020, the station was used by an average of 4 passengers daily.[2]
